How they compare
Japan currently reports 249 1000 ha against 234.56 1000 ha in Guinea-Bissau, a difference of 14.44 1000 ha.
That makes Japan's figure about 1.1 times Guinea-Bissau's.
Across all 64 years both countries report, Japan has been ahead every year.
Guinea-Bissau ranks 85th and Japan ranks 84th of 220 countries.
Japan has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Guinea-Bissau | Japan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 43 1000 ha | 499.67 1000 ha | 456.67 1000 ha | Japan |
| 1970s | 43.4 1000 ha | 614.7 1000 ha | 571.3 1000 ha | Japan |
| 1980s | 74.2 1000 ha | 548.1 1000 ha | 473.9 1000 ha | Japan |
| 1990s | 146.5 1000 ha | 416.5 1000 ha | 270 1000 ha | Japan |
| 2000s | 250.67 1000 ha | 334.2 1000 ha | 83.53 1000 ha | Japan |
| 2010s | 254.88 1000 ha | 292.9 1000 ha | 38.02 1000 ha | Japan |
| 2020s | 244.47 1000 ha | 258.6 1000 ha | 14.13 1000 ha | Japan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The FAOSTAT Land Use domain contains data on twenty-one land use categories and twenty-three categories of irrigation and agricultural practices. Data are available yearly and by country, regional and global levels. The domain includes Land Use Indicators providing information on the percentage share of agricultural and forest land, and their sub-components, including irrigated areas and areas under organic agriculture, within a country land use matrix. Data are available at country, regional and global level, for the following elements: (in percentage) i) Share in Land area; ii) Share in Agricultural land, iii) Share in Cropland; and iv) Share in Forest land; (in ha/pc) v) Area per capita.
